The official opening ceremony of Mido 2026 will take place at 10.30am on Saturday 31 January at the Fashion Square, Pavilion 1, Fieramilano Rho, Milan, with more than 40,000 visitors from all over the world expected to attend across the three-day show.
Approximately 1,200 exhibitors, including 270 Italian and 930 international companies from nearly 50 countries, will showcase their products across seven pavilions. More than 20 workshops are planned, alongside the annual awards – from the Best Store Award to the new CSE Corporate Award.
